A long period of inflation can be triggered when the inflaton is held up onthe top of a steep potential by the infrared end of a warped space. We firststudy the field theory description of such a model. We then embed it in theflux stabilized string compactification. Some special effects in the throatreheating process by relativistic branes are discussed. We put all theseingredients into a multi-throat brane inflationary scenario. The resultingcosmic string tension and a multi-throat slow-roll model are also discussed.Comment: 39 pages; v4, added reference, to appear in JHE
